Output d36a2f950e26adf356b07629afbf5cd5699103c6b87e9945b62c348171ada186:1

value
156985120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1efa90c4b1550538a6285bf5eb831957c42bc137 OP_EQUAL
address
34WpMtrijia8hHWnFrywXtXwbjzbL1ScjM
transaction
d36a2f950e26adf356b07629afbf5cd5699103c6b87e9945b62c348171ada186
spent
true